In Uttar Pradesh, at least 20 coaches of the Sabarmati Express passenger train derailed between Kanpur and Bhimsen station at 2:30 am on Saturday, a Railway Board official said. "No injury to any person has been reported as of now," the official said. "The loco pilot said that some boulder hit the cattle guard (front portion) of the engine which got badly damaged and bent," he added. As per information,Buses have reached the site to take the passengers to Kanpur.
